A make-or-break moment for ECOWAS? West African summit on Niger coup underway

Description

Nigeria's President Bola Tinubu said West African leaders should try all diplomatic routes to ensure a swift return to constitutional rule in Niger, including dialogue with the coup leaders there, as a summit of heads of state began on Thursday. The Economic Community of West African States (ECOWAS) must decide how to respond to the junta, which defied an Aug. 6 deadline to stand down, instead closing Niger's airspace and vowing to defend the country against any foreign attack.
